Oklahoma City Thunder head coach Mark Daigneault acknowledged that Chet Holmgren's struggles in the Western Conference Finals were not solely his own, but indicative of broader team issues. Holmgren faced difficulties that were interlinked with the team's overall performance during the series. Daigneault’s comments reflect a need for the Thunder to address collective shortcomings moving forward. The organization plans to evaluate strategies to improve team cohesion ahead of the next season.
